Overview

The Sprint Planning for Faster Agile Team Delivery Certificate from EdX in partnership with University System of Maryland - USMx.

Speed is by far the most sought-after benefit of Agile. 

First mover advantages, the economic cost of delays, and the enabling effect on innovation drive the search for speed. Agile offers the fastest means of attaining speed: managing scope. But beyond the hype over scope management, there are key principles of non-traditional task management that ensure the scope chosen is delivered as efficiently as possible. 

In this course, you’ll learn how to drive speed into any project by selecting and limiting work-in-progress through agile planning and task management.

What you will learn

  • Kanban boards to limit work-in-progress (WIP)
  • Time boxing activities to eliminate delays and gain schedule advances
  • Application and iteration of the Pareto Principle
  • Rolling Wave Planning

Programme Structure

Courses include:

  • Week 1: The first week focuses the discussion on Agile to its primary benefit, Speed, and how to easily calculate and prove its supremacy in benefits of any project management method because of timing impacts and market changes outside a project manager’s control.
  • Week 2: The second week explores why and how varying scope is the most powerful method to achieve speed; introducing the Exponential Pareto Principle and how to apply it effectively.
  • Week 3: The third week dives into second tier methods for achieving speed through sizing, simplicity, and sprints with real-world examples ranging from air and space craft to software.
  • Week 4: The last week teaches ground-level techniques to avoid delays, increase speed, and apply a full range of planning, execution, and control techniques that will guarantee 2x or better improvement on traditional projects.
